  1. (A) Enpen and TriCurin-Enpen were stored in the dark at 4 °C for 3.5 months. HeLa cells were exposed to increasing concentrations of Enpen or TriCurin-Enpen for 96 h and the number of viable cells was determined by the MTT assay, as described in the “Methods” section.
  2. *Two-tailed T test.
  3. (B,C) Organotypic human vaginal-ectocervical (VEC) tissue (EpiVaginal, MaTtek, MA) was used to test the toxicity of:
  4. (B) Enpen compared to two positive control creams known to be toxic: Gynol II, 1% Triton X-100, as described in the “Methods” section.
  5. *T-s: T statistics; **P-v: p value.
  6. (C) TrCurin-Enpen and Enpen cream compared to two positive control creams known to be toxic Vagisil (benzocaine 5%, resorcinol 2%) and Gynol II (nonoxynol-9 (3%), as described in the “Methods” section.
